adj. 不一致的,不調和的;前后矛盾的,不合邏輯的;反復無常的;歧出
inconsistent 不一致的
in-,不,非,consistent,一致的。
用作形容詞(adj.)
- His accounts of the event were inconsistent.
他對那件事情的說法前后不一致。 - Such behavior is inconsistent with her high-minded principles.
這樣的行為與她情操高尚的原則是矛盾的。 - English weather is very inconsistent; one moment it's raining and the next it's sunny.
英國的天氣反復無常,一會兒下雨,一會兒又放晴。 - He is inconsistent in his loyalty: sometimes he supports us, sometimes he's against us.
他并非一貫忠心耿耿,有時支持我們,有時反對我們。
